K904127 is an FDA 510(k) clearance for the A2J TELEMETER. Classified as Monitor, Patient Position, Light-beam (product code IWE), Class I - General Controls.

Submitted by A2j, Inc. (Fredericksburg, US). The FDA issued a Cleared decision on January 4, 1991 after a review of 128 days - within the typical 510(k) review window.

This device falls under the Radiology FDA review panel, regulated under 21 CFR 892.5780 - the FDA radiology and imaging software oversight framework. The Traditional 510(k) pathway establishes clearance through subst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device, without requiring clinical trial data.
